#dce7a4 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#dce7a4 is composed of 86.3% red, 90.6% green and 64.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 4.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 29% yellow and 9.4% black. It has a hue angle of 69.9 degrees, a saturation of 58.3% and a lightness of 77.5%. #dce7a4 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#b9cf49. Closest websafe color is: #ccff99.

Shades and Tints of #dce7a4

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020201 is the darkest color, while #fafbf2 is the lightest one.

Tones of #dce7a4

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#c7c8c3 is the less saturated color, while #ebfd8e is the most saturated one.
